Re: WIP Hasselfree Hellboy
« Reply #23 on: June 17, 2011, 03:11:43 AM »
The Harby figure comes with an alternate "Right Hand of Doom" and a (hornless) Hellboy-esque head. One must add one's own horns, tail, etc. (as seen in the thread).
